The Science of Stimulation: How Energy Drinks Affect Your Brain
The primary mechanism behind an energy drink's ability to keep you awake is its high caffeine content. Caffeine is a central nervous system stimulant that works by interfering with a natural chemical process in your brain.
The Role of Adenosine
Throughout the day, a chemical called adenosine builds up in your brain. This is part of the body's natural sleep-wake cycle. The more adenosine that accumulates, the sleepier you feel. It essentially acts as a signal to your body that it's time to slow down and rest. Caffeine is effective precisely because it subverts this natural process.
How Caffeine Blocks Sleepiness
When you consume an energy drink, the caffeine enters your bloodstream and binds to the adenosine receptors in your brain. Because caffeine has a similar molecular structure, it effectively blocks the adenosine from attaching to its receptors. This prevents the sleep signal from being sent, leaving you feeling alert and awake—temporarily.
The Highs and Lows: Why the Boost Isn't Sustainable
While the caffeine and other stimulants in energy drinks can provide a temporary feeling of wakefulness, this effect is often fleeting and can lead to a detrimental cycle of dependency and fatigue. Several factors contribute to this unsustainable energy model.
The Inevitable Sugar Crash
Many energy drinks contain extremely high levels of added sugar, sometimes exceeding the recommended daily limit in a single can. This influx of sugar causes a rapid spike in blood glucose levels, giving you a burst of energy. However, this is quickly followed by a sharp drop, known as a 'sugar crash.' This crash can leave you feeling more tired, irritable, and sluggish than you were before, sending you searching for another energy fix.
The Caffeine Tolerance Trap
Over time, your body adapts to regular caffeine consumption by developing a tolerance. Your brain may increase the number of adenosine receptors to compensate for the blocking effect of caffeine. This means you need more and more caffeine to achieve the same level of alertness, creating a cycle of dependency. This tolerance also makes the subsequent withdrawal more severe, with common symptoms including fatigue, headaches, and difficulty concentrating.
Potential Health Effects of Energy Drink Consumption
Beyond the temporary energy boosts and crashes, habitual energy drink use can have significant adverse effects on your health. Medical professionals advise caution, particularly for young people.
Common Negative Effects:
- Cardiovascular Issues: The combination of caffeine, guarana, and other stimulants can increase heart rate and blood pressure. Studies have linked excessive consumption to heart palpitations, arrhythmias, and in rare cases, more serious cardiac events.
- Disrupted Sleep Patterns: Even if you feel you can sleep after an energy drink, the caffeine can interfere with sleep quality and delay your sleep-wake cycle. This leads to less restorative sleep, perpetuating daytime fatigue.
- Increased Anxiety and Jitters: The stimulating effects of caffeine can induce feelings of anxiety, nervousness, and restlessness, especially in those sensitive to stimulants or consuming high doses.
- Dehydration: Caffeine is a diuretic, meaning it increases urine production and can lead to dehydration, which itself is a common cause of fatigue.
- Dental Problems: The high sugar and acid content in many energy drinks can lead to dental erosion and cavities.
Energy Drinks vs. Healthier Energy Boosters
Rather than relying on energy drinks, numerous healthier and more sustainable alternatives can provide a lasting energy lift without the negative side effects. The table below compares the typical effects and ingredients of energy drinks with those of healthier alternatives.
| Feature | Energy Drinks | Healthier Alternatives (e.g., Green Tea, Water) |
|---|---|---|
| Ingredients | High caffeine, sugar, taurine, guarana, B vitamins | Natural caffeine (often lower dose), antioxidants, water |
| Energy Boost | Immediate, short-lived spike followed by a crash | Gradual, sustained energy with no major crash |
| Effect on Sleep | High potential for sleep disruption, insomnia, and poor quality rest | Minimal or no effect on sleep, depending on timing and quantity |
| Risk of Dependency | High due to caffeine and sugar tolerance | Low to moderate, depending on caffeine source and usage |
| Additional Health Effects | Cardiovascular strain, anxiety, dental issues, dehydration | Hydration benefits, antioxidant intake, lower risk of health complications |
Embracing Natural Wakefulness
For a truly effective and healthy approach to staying awake, consider these alternatives: Healthier Energy-Boosting Strategies from Northwestern Medicine
- Stay Hydrated: Dehydration is a major cause of fatigue. Drinking plenty of water throughout the day can prevent slumps.
- Eat Regular, Healthy Meals: Avoid skipping meals and opt for balanced snacks with protein, healthy fats, and complex carbs to keep your blood sugar steady.
- Incorporate Physical Activity: Even a short walk can release endorphins and norepinephrine, natural chemicals that help you feel more alert.
- Prioritize Quality Sleep: Nothing replaces a good night's rest. For long-term energy and health, establishing a consistent sleep schedule is paramount.
Conclusion: More Harm than Help for Lasting Wakefulness
Do energy drinks actually keep you awake? The short answer is yes, they provide a temporary, artificially-induced boost of alertness. However, this is not a sustainable solution and comes at a cost. The high levels of caffeine and sugar create an inevitable cycle of highs and crashes that can significantly disrupt sleep, impair cognitive function, and cause a range of other serious health issues, especially with chronic use. For genuine, lasting energy, relying on a balanced diet, proper hydration, regular exercise, and consistent, high-quality sleep is the only truly effective strategy.
